**Heads up: the mail room has moved!**

As of this week, the Quillford mail room lives on the ground floor of the Alder Wing, next to the print hub — not up on level 4 anymore. Team assistants collecting post should swing by between 10:00 and 15:00. The new room is keypad-locked, so punch in the door code below to get in.

staff pass of kajef-yafog = bdg-A-89

BRIEFING — Leadership Review, for incoming director

Subject: logistics provider change at Marovale Goods. We exit the Tallis Freight contract at year-end; Quendon Haulage takes over all routes from the Elmsworth hub. Drivers: cost down 9%, better cold-chain coverage. Risks: transition overlap in weeks one to three. Contingency stock pre-positioned. Contracts signed; comms pending. One confidential matter follows for your eyes.

management briefing: Only 14 of the 251 pilot accounts renewed Queniel, so a churn review is set for April 11. Keloxox Foods is in early talks to buy Lamathix Freight for about $358.4 million.

**Ticket: EXIF scrubber drift between nodes**

The Tinwhistle image pipeline scrubs EXIF on upload, but node three kept GPS tags last week. Manual edits during the outage were never backported to the deploy manifest, so nodes now disagree. Treat the manifest as the single source of truth and redeploy all nodes. The canonical settings are these.

config for kajog-tadug:
[casax]
port = 11211
region = west-3
host = casax.nelvroworks.internal
timeout_ms = 5000
retries = 7